About Helmut Kloos

Helmut Kloos is a scholar working on Nutrition and Dietetics, Parasitology,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health, General Health Professions and Sociology and Political Science, having authored 206 papers that have together received 4.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Child Nutrition and Water Access (50 papers), Parasites and Host Interactions (46 papers), Global Maternal and Child Health (33 papers), Poverty, Education, and Child Welfare (13 papers), HIV/AIDS Impact and Responses (12 papers), Constructed Wetlands for Wastewater Treatment (10 papers), HIV/AIDS Research and Interventions (9 papers) and Wastewater Treatment and Reuse (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Parasitology (1.1k citations), Nutrition and Dietetics (801 citations), Water Science and Technology (614 citations),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(722 citations) and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ering (343 citations). Helmut Kloos has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Ethiopia and Brazil. Frequent co-authors include Andréa Gazzinelli, Worku Legesse, Worku Mulat, Metadel Adane, Rodrigo Corrêa‐Oliveira, Bezatu Mengistie, Abebe Beyene, Girmay Medhin, Damen Haile Mariam and Ludwig Triest. Their work appears in journals such as Social Science & Medicine, PLoS ONE, Memórias do Instituto Oswaldo Cruz, Northeast African Studies and Acta Tropica.
